From c0aac5975bafc86f6817b14e9f71dcb5064a9183 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Mateusz Guzik Date: Wed, 3 Dec 2025 10:28:50 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] ns: pad refcount Note no effort is made to make sure structs embedding the namespace are themselves aligned, so this is not guaranteed to eliminate cacheline bouncing due to refcount management.
